Board Announcement Club releases statement detailing Boardroom changes. Bristol City Football Club has announced key boardroom moves linked to changes to the business structure and responsibilities of the club’s executive team. Jon Lansdown, previously Managing Director, will step up to become the club’s Vice Chairman, assisting current Chairman Keith Dawe. Doug Harman takes on the role of Chief Executive, whilst the four-man Board is completed by Ernie Arathoon, recently appointed a Non-Executive Director. JonLansdownsmallChairman Dawe said: “The club has gone through a significant period of adjustment and rationalisation over the last few months. “As a result a number of changes have been made at Board level affecting key areas of the business. “Jon Lansdown moves to become Vice Chairman and Doug Harman becomes the club’s Chief Executive with immediate effect. “Doug will take overall responsibility for football and our Academy, as well as the commercial, financial and operational aspects of our business. “In addition, Ernie Arathoon is a welcome and recent addition to the Board as a Non-Executive Director.” Additionally, John Pelling has been appointed as the new Academy Director of Operations. Pelling is currently working with Sheffield Wednesday and was previously with Nottingham Forest at Board level for more than 15 years. He will take up his post from the end of the month. Meanwhile, Development Director Guy Price is to leave the club at the end of this month. Price has decided to combine other business opportunities and is considering undertaking an MBA at Loughborough University. Dawe added: “Guy has worked long and hard for the club over the years and we thank him for his contribution and efforts. He leaves with our best wishes for the future.”
